11.5. Verifying Game Files Integrity

Encountering issues in Garry's Mod, from crashes to missing textures, can often be resolved by verifying the integrity of your game files. This process ensures that all game files are present, correct, and up-to-date, preventing many common technical problems.

Verifying the integrity of game files is a crucial troubleshooting step for any Steam game, including Garry's Mod. This process is handled directly through the Steam client. When you verify game files, Steam checks all the installed files for Garry's Mod against a master list of what they should be. If any files are missing, corrupted, or have been modified incorrectly, Steam will automatically download and replace them. This is particularly useful after installing new addons, experiencing unexpected crashes, or noticing graphical glitches like missing textures or incorrect models. To initiate the process, open your Steam Library, right-click on 'Garry's Mod', and select 'Properties'. In the Properties window, navigate to the 'Local Files' tab. You will see an option labeled 'Verify integrity of game files...'. Clicking this will start the verification process. Steam will then scan your game files, which may take a few minutes depending on the size of your installation and the speed of your internet connection. Once completed, Steam will inform you if any files needed to be re-downloaded. After the verification is finished, it's recommended to restart Steam and then launch Garry's Mod to see if the issue has been resolved. Here's how to verify your game files:

  1. Open Steam Library: Launch the Steam client and go to your Library.
  2. Locate Garry's Mod: Find Garry's Mod in your list of games.
  3. Access Properties: Right-click on Garry's Mod and select 'Properties'.
  4. Go to Local Files: In the Properties window, click on the 'Local Files' tab.
  5. Verify Integrity: Click the 'Verify integrity of game files...' button.
  6. Wait for Completion: Steam will scan and download any necessary files.
  7. Restart and Test: Restart Steam, launch Garry's Mod, and check if the problem is fixed.

If verifying game files doesn't resolve your issue, it might indicate a problem with your addons, your system drivers, or a more complex configuration issue. In such cases, you might consider unsubscribing from recently added addons one by one to identify a problematic one, or updating your graphics drivers.
